REPUBLIKA.CO.ID, DEPOK -- The Ministry of Agriculture (Kementan) educates the public to diversify local food, including taro beneng, which is an alternative food source and thrives as a wild plant or as a result of cultivation. Minister of Agriculture Syahrul Yasin Limpo (SYL) in a written press statement, Monday (7/3/2022), said Indonesia is very rich in local food. "In Indonesia, all regions have local food. Therefore, we invite people to take advantage of local food diversification to meet food needs, including using taro beneng," he said. Minister of Agriculture SYL added that the task of the Ministry of Agriculture is to meet the food needs of the entire community and that food needs can be met by maximizing local food diversification.
